Нажмите «Неустранимая Python ошибка» при создании JEP SubInterpreter в Java - PullRequest
0 голосов
/ 10 апреля 2020

Я получил следующую ошибку при создании JEP SubInterpreter в Java на Windows 10:

Fatal Python error: init_sys_streams: can't initialize sys standard streams
Python runtime state: core initialized
OSError: [WinError 6] The handle is invalid

И затем процесс завершился.

Эта ошибка не возникает каждый раз , почти одна десятая.

Есть идеи об этой ошибке?

Спасибо!

1 Ответ

0 голосов
/ 14 апреля 2020

Это вызвано freopen () в коде C, замените его на fopen (), и dup2 () может это исправить. Пожалуйста, обратитесь к: https://github.com/ninia/jep/issues/242

...